Hand roll lovers, head to the second floor! 📌 In summary: We chose the $78/person, which includes both Japanese and Australian Wagyu. The main difference with higher-tier packages is the variety of seafood and number of special dishes. For a date night for two, the $78 option is the ultimate value pick. We noticed a membership discount on the menu — asked our server and learned: ✅ One membership covers two people ✅ Get a free premium hand roll or mocktail (worth nearly $20) ✅ Happy Hour: Mon–Thu, 5–7 PM, with discounted drinks (some even 50% off!)
